Class Representative Tells U.S. High Court Review Of Attorney Fees Isn’t Needed

Mealey's (February 14, 2023, 1:11 PM EST) -- WASHINGTON, D.C. — A class representative who negotiated a Telephone Consumer Protection Act (TCPA) settlement of more than $1.4 million but who was denied an incentive award by a divided 11th Circuit U.S. Court of Appeals panel filed a brief on Feb. 13 in the U.S. Supreme Court opposing an objector’s petition asking the justices to review the class counsel fees and arguing that the objector already obtained relief from the 11th Circuit....
